Key Ceremony Checklist — Step 12: Cold Storage Archive Keys. Okay folks, this one matters for support. We're sealing the encryption keys for the Tidemark cold storage buckets — the ones holding archived customer exports older than two years. Double-check that last week's archive sweep finished and the bucket manifests match the ledger printout. Once both custodians nod, the archive vault locks for good. Support can only reopen it during a declared incident, using the recovery passphrase recorded below.

vault phrase of taweg-kafof = oliax-zorael

## Lintwall Baseline

The static-analysis baseline for Corvette lives in `baseline.lintwall` at repo root. Never edit it by hand. To suppress legacy findings, run `lintwall freeze` and commit the result. CI fails on any new finding not in the baseline. If the scanner version bumps, regenerate before merging. The scanner reads its settings at startup; the current values are listed below.

settings of yageg-yahap:
[gorael]
team = olieth
access_code = ac_941d74
owner = brieth.aldiel
host = gorael.tolvaqio.internal
port = 6379
peer = briwyn.urlaqtech.internal
salt = 116e6622
pin = 1957

## Formula sandbox tuning

User-supplied formulas in Gridmoor execute inside a restricted interpreter with hard ceilings on time, memory, and call depth. Reviewers should confirm any change to these ceilings is justified in the PR description, since raising them widens the abuse surface. Defaults were chosen from production traces. The current limits are as follows.

limits module of tafog-fawip:
WEIGHTS = {
    "julix": 57,
    "lamys": 992,
    "kasvan": 209,
    "quenok": 750,
    "alddor": 259,
    "oliath": 1009,
    "wenix": 815,
}

### Step 4: Port the audio-guide settings

When migrating EchoDocent from the legacy Marnhall backend to the new streaming service, copy the playback and caching settings before cutover. Tour stops are keyed by gallery zone, so a mismatch here will desync the narration from the exhibit map. Verify the prefetch depth matches what the old service used. The values to carry over are listed below.

deployment values, yahag-tawef:
ZORWYN_HOST=zorwyn.tolvaqlabs.internal
ZORWYN_PORT=9300